Subject:      Re: need to "See the light"

Joel Walker said the following in reply to the issue of instrument panel lighting (much is snipped here for brevity): > > i don't recall if there was a light on the gearshift or not ... :( > Actually, if you remove the "PRND21" cover from the automatic transmission shift console, you'll find two tiny, tiny lamps that move with the shifter.

Mine are also blown out, and I'd sure like to know whether or not they're removable, since I'm sorta reluctant to apply overwhelming force to these fragile little bulbs without someone telling me that I'm not going to "break the transmission" by doing it.
